Matthew Oelslager Joins Vantage Pointe Inc.

By Christina Haley O'Neal, posted May 8, 2018
Matthew Oelslager
Vantage Pointe Inc. has welcomed Matthew Oelslager as its new assistant director, according to a news release.

Oelslager joins Vantage Pointe after nearly 15 years in the mental health field, during which time he served clients and their families, worked in suicide intervention, crisis de-escalation, and program development.

As assistant director, Oelslager will be responsible for directing New Hanover County Teen Court, assisting with training, and development and community outreach. He will help Vantage Pointe to continue to grow and better serve the community.

Vantage Pointe provides the tools, training and support to build or transform relationships.

This includes offering mediation, facilitation, and training to families, businesses, and the community.

Currently, Vantage Pointe works with families, agencies, organizations and companies in the greater Cape Fear region, including Bladen, Brunswick, Columbus, New Hanover and Pender counties.
